      1 /* SPDX-License-Identifier: GPL-2.0 WITH Linux-syscall-note */
      2 /*
      3  *  linux/include/asm/setup.h
      4  *
      5  *  Copyright (C) 1997-1999 Russell King
      6  *
      7  * This program is free software; you can redistribute it and/or modify
      8  * it under the terms of the GNU General Public License version 2 as
      9  * published by the Free Software Foundation.
     10  *
     11  *  Structure passed to kernel to tell it about the
     12  *  hardware it's running on.  See Documentation/arm/Setup
     13  *  for more info.
     14  */
     15 #ifndef _UAPI__ASMARM_SETUP_H
     16 #define _UAPI__ASMARM_SETUP_H
     17 
     18 #include <linux/types.h>
     19 
     20 #define COMMAND_LINE_SIZE 1024
     21 
     22 /* The list ends with an ATAG_NONE node. */
     23 #define ATAG_NONE	0x00000000
     24 
     25 struct tag_header {
     26 	__u32 size;
     27 	__u32 tag;
     28 };
     29 
     30 /* The list must start with an ATAG_CORE node */
     31 #define ATAG_CORE	0x54410001
     32 
     33 struct tag_core {
     34 	__u32 flags;		/* bit 0 = read-only */
     35 	__u32 pagesize;
     36 	__u32 rootdev;
     37 };
     38 
     39 /* it is allowed to have multiple ATAG_MEM nodes */
     40 #define ATAG_MEM	0x54410002
     41 
     42 struct tag_mem32 {
     43 	__u32	size;
     44 	__u32	start;	/* physical start address */
     45 };
     46 
     47 /* VGA text type displays */
     48 #define ATAG_VIDEOTEXT	0x54410003
     49 
     50 struct tag_videotext {
     51 	__u8		x;
     52 	__u8		y;
     53 	__u16		video_page;
     54 	__u8		video_mode;
     55 	__u8		video_cols;
     56 	__u16		video_ega_bx;
     57 	__u8		video_lines;
     58 	__u8		video_isvga;
     59 	__u16		video_points;
     60 };
     61 
     62 /* describes how the ramdisk will be used in kernel */
     63 #define ATAG_RAMDISK	0x54410004
     64 
     65 struct tag_ramdisk {
     66 	__u32 flags;	/* bit 0 = load, bit 1 = prompt */
     67 	__u32 size;	/* decompressed ramdisk size in _kilo_ bytes */
     68 	__u32 start;	/* starting block of floppy-based RAM disk image */
     69 };
     70 
     71 /* describes where the compressed ramdisk image lives (virtual address) */
     72 /*
     73  * this one accidentally used virtual addresses - as such,
     74  * it's deprecated.
     75  */
     76 #define ATAG_INITRD	0x54410005
     77 
     78 /* describes where the compressed ramdisk image lives (physical address) */
     79 #define ATAG_INITRD2	0x54420005
     80 
     81 struct tag_initrd {
     82 	__u32 start;	/* physical start address */
     83 	__u32 size;	/* size of compressed ramdisk image in bytes */
     84 };
     85 
     86 /* board serial number. "64 bits should be enough for everybody" */
     87 #define ATAG_SERIAL	0x54410006
     88 
     89 struct tag_serialnr {
     90 	__u32 low;
     91 	__u32 high;
     92 };
     93 
     94 /* board revision */
     95 #define ATAG_REVISION	0x54410007
     96 
     97 struct tag_revision {
     98 	__u32 rev;
     99 };
    100 
    101 /* initial values for vesafb-type framebuffers. see struct screen_info
    102  * in include/linux/tty.h
    103  */
    104 #define ATAG_VIDEOLFB	0x54410008
    105 
    106 struct tag_videolfb {
    107 	__u16		lfb_width;
    108 	__u16		lfb_height;
    109 	__u16		lfb_depth;
    110 	__u16		lfb_linelength;
    111 	__u32		lfb_base;
    112 	__u32		lfb_size;
    113 	__u8		red_size;
    114 	__u8		red_pos;
    115 	__u8		green_size;
    116 	__u8		green_pos;
    117 	__u8		blue_size;
    118 	__u8		blue_pos;
    119 	__u8		rsvd_size;
    120 	__u8		rsvd_pos;
    121 };
    122 
    123 /* command line: \0 terminated string */
    124 #define ATAG_CMDLINE	0x54410009
    125 
    126 struct tag_cmdline {
    127 	char	cmdline[1];	/* this is the minimum size */
    128 };
    129 
    130 /* acorn RiscPC specific information */
    131 #define ATAG_ACORN	0x41000101
    132 
    133 struct tag_acorn {
    134 	__u32 memc_control_reg;
    135 	__u32 vram_pages;
    136 	__u8 sounddefault;
    137 	__u8 adfsdrives;
    138 };
    139 
    140 /* footbridge memory clock, see arch/arm/mach-footbridge/arch.c */
    141 #define ATAG_MEMCLK	0x41000402
    142 
    143 struct tag_memclk {
    144 	__u32 fmemclk;
    145 };
    146 
    147 struct tag {
    148 	struct tag_header hdr;
    149 	union {
    150 		struct tag_core		core;
    151 		struct tag_mem32	mem;
    152 		struct tag_videotext	videotext;
    153 		struct tag_ramdisk	ramdisk;
    154 		struct tag_initrd	initrd;
    155 		struct tag_serialnr	serialnr;
    156 		struct tag_revision	revision;
    157 		struct tag_videolfb	videolfb;
    158 		struct tag_cmdline	cmdline;
    159 
    160 		/*
    161 		 * Acorn specific
    162 		 */
    163 		struct tag_acorn	acorn;
    164 
    165 		/*
    166 		 * DC21285 specific
    167 		 */
    168 		struct tag_memclk	memclk;
    169 	} u;
    170 };
    171 
    172 struct tagtable {
    173 	__u32 tag;
    174 	int (*parse)(const struct tag *);
    175 };
    176 
    177 #define tag_member_present(tag,member)				\
    178 	((unsigned long)(&((struct tag *)0L)->member + 1)	\
    179 		<= (tag)->hdr.size * 4)
    180 
    181 #define tag_next(t)	((struct tag *)((__u32 *)(t) + (t)->hdr.size))
    182 #define tag_size(type)	((sizeof(struct tag_header) + sizeof(struct type)) >> 2)
    183 
    184 #define for_each_tag(t,base)		\
    185 	for (t = base; t->hdr.size; t = tag_next(t))
    186 
    187 
    188 #endif /* _UAPI__ASMARM_SETUP_H */
